#ba23b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ba23b9 is composed of 72.9% red, 13.7%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.2%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 300.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#ba23b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ff with #750073.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#ba23b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ba23b9 has RGB values of R:186, G:35,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.01,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12198841.

Shades and Tints of #ba23b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ba23b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766776 is the less saturated color, while #dc01db is the most saturated one.
